c语言期末不挂科知识点大一
C语言期末不挂科的知识点
C语言作为计算机专业的入门编程语言,对于大一的学生来说是非常重要的一门课程。期末考试即将到来,为了帮助大家更好地复习和备考,本文将总结C语言期末考试中的知识点,希望能帮助大家顺利通过考试。
一、基本语法和数据类型
1.1 C语言的基本语法结构:包括注释、标识符、关键字、变量、常量、运算符和控制语句等。
1.2 C语言的数据类型:包括整型、浮点型、字符型和枚举型等。了解各种数据类型的范围和占用内存大小。
1.3 变量的声明和定义:了解变量的命名规则和使用方法,以及变量的作用域和生命周期。
1.4 运算符的分类和使用:包括算术运算符、关系运算符、逻辑运算符和位运算符等。结构体数组不能作为参数传递给函数
二、控制语句
2.1 条件语句:包括if语句、if-else语句、嵌套if语句和switch语句等。
2.2 循环语句:包括for循环、while循环和do-while循环等,了解各种循环语句的使用场景和注意事项。
2.3 跳转语句:包括break语句、continue语句和goto语句等。
三、数组和字符串
3.1 数组的定义和初始化:了解一维数组和多维数组的声明方法,以及对数组元素的访问和操作。
3.2 字符串的处理:包括字符串的初始化、复制、连接和比较等常见操作。
3.3 字符串函数的使用:了解常见的字符串函数,如strlen、strcpy、strcat和strcmp等。
四、函数和指针
4.1 函数的定义和调用:了解函数的定义格式,包括函数名、参数和返回值。
4.2 函数的参数传递:了解值传递和引用传递的区别,以及函数的递归调用。
4.3 指针的基本概念:了解指针的定义和运算符,如取地址运算符和间接访问运算符。
4.4 指针和数组的关系:了解指针和数组之间的关联,以及指针数组和数组指针的使用方法。
五、结构体和文件操作
5.1 结构体的定义和使用:了解结构体的成员和对结构体变量的操作,包括结构体数组和结构体指针的使用。
5.2 文件的打开和关闭:了解文件的打开模式和文件指针的使用方法。
5.3 文件的读写操作:了解常见的文件读写函数,如fopen、fclose、fscanf和fprintf等。
六、动态内存分配和模块化编程
6.1 动态内存分配:了解动态内存分配的概念和使用方法,包括malloc、calloc和free等函数。
6.2 模块化编程:了解程序的模块化设计思想和函数的分文件编写方式,以便提高代码的可读性和可维护性。
以上是C语言期末考试不挂科的主要知识点总结。希望大家认真复习,多做练习题和编程实践,熟悉掌握这些知识点。相信只要你们用心学习,充分准备,一定能取得好成绩。加油!
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。
发表评论